During a financial emergency, the executive authority of the union exercises control over state finances through the following measures: (1) It can issue directions to state to observe certain cannons of financial propriety (2) It can ask the states to reserve their money bills for the consideration of the president (3) It can direct the states to reduce the salaries and allowances of all the persons serving in connection with the affairs of the states, including the judges of the Supreme Court and High Courts Codes:

Option A: (1) and (2)
Option B: Only (1)
Option C: (2) and (3)
Option D: (1), (2) and (3)

Correct Answer

Option: d

Explanation

President can impose financial emergency if he is satisfied that a situation has arisen due to which financial stability or credit of India or any part of it is in danger. The proclamation must be approved by both the houses of Parliament within two months of its issue. The effects of Financial emergency are that President can direct the reduction of salaries and allowances of any dass of employees serving the state and postponement of the salary of Public servants amongst other directions.
